Transaction c34eb66a9c4f6686355f3848efb2d6ab2a0a540fd3c8f117f5d5971c9804ef20

block
4eb1b596db15db82f1f0ee27cf6deac415712105224e7eaa06c4ed644213b2e9

1 Input

23 Outputs